A graceful blend of vintage elegance and modern design, the Blanc Héritage Necklace celebrates the beauty of historic materials through thoughtful craftsmanship and timeless style.
The necklace is handcrafted with authentic vintage Japanese glass beads from the original Miriam Haskell stock. Produced in the mid-twentieth century and treasured for their exceptional quality, these classic white beads are individually hand-pinned on sterling silver pins and thoughtfully linked together, creating a fluid, luminous silhouette that drapes beautifully along the neckline.
At the center rests an antique silver-and-gold coin connector charm, lending a sense of history and architectural balance to the design. Additional antique coin connectors are positioned along the necklace, framing segments of the vintage beads and creating visual rhythm throughout the piece.
As the necklace transitions toward the clasp, a bold sterling silver statement paperclip chain introduces a contemporary contrast to the softness of the vintage glass. The result is a striking balance between old and new, refined and bold, heirloom and modern.
Finished with a substantial sterling silver magnetic clasp and removable double-ended lobster clasp, the necklace offers both security and versatility, allowing the wearer to adjust the length and styling as desired.

General Care
• Avoid water, perfumes, lotions, and harsh chemicals
• Remove jewelry before swimming, showering, or exercising
• Store in a dry place, preferably in your gift box or a soft pouch
• Gently wipe with a soft cloth after wear to maintain shine
Sterling Silver
• Naturally prone to tarnish—this is normal
• Use a polishing cloth to restore shine
• Store in an anti-tarnish pouch or sealed bag when not in use
